Description

Viking Electronics K-1205-EWP Apartment Entry Phone with Color Video Camera

The Viking Electronics K-1205-EWP is a 12-button, hands-free apartment entry phone with a built-in color video camera, integrated door strike relay, and enhanced weather protection — purpose-built for multi-tenant residential and commercial entry control where durability, vandal resistance, and reliable two-way communication are non-negotiable. At 5" x 10" x 2.5" (127mm x 254mm x 63.5mm), it fits standard rough-in boxes and supports both flush and surface mounting, with the optional VE-5x10 enclosure extending its deployment range into exposed outdoor environments. This is a Viking Electronics entry system designed for installers who need a proven, field-serviceable solution without complex IP infrastructure.

Overview

The K-1205-EWP handles up to 12 tenant positions with 22-digit speed dial capacity per button — enough for direct extension dialing across most small-to-mid-size apartment buildings. The built-in door strike relay and a dedicated camera relay mean you're not sourcing external relay modules; both strike control and video switching are integrated into a single, UL-listed enclosure. As a surface or flush-mount entry intercom, it competes on installation simplicity: wire power, connect the phone lines and strike, mount the plate.

Key Features

  • 316 Stainless Steel Faceplate (14-gauge, louvered): Marine-grade 316 stainless resists chloride corrosion — meaningful if the entry point is near saltwater, a pool area, or in a coastal climate where lesser alloys pit and stain within a season. Laser-etched graphics won't fade or peel under UV or cleaning chemicals.
  • 12 Tenant Buttons with 22-Digit Speed Dial: Each of the 12 buttons stores up to 22 digits, supporting extension numbers, access codes, or off-site call-forwarding strings. The 12 alternate number positions let you program a backup number per tenant — useful in buildings where management wants calls to roll to a cell if the unit doesn't answer.
  • Integrated Door Strike Relay (5A @ 30VDC / 250VAC): The onboard strike relay handles up to 5 amps at 30VDC or 250VAC, which covers virtually every electric strike and magnetic lock on the market. No separate relay board, no extra junction box — the control circuit is native to the panel.
  • Integrated Camera Relay (0.5A @ 125VAC / 1.0A @ 30VDC): A second relay dedicated to the camera circuit allows video switching or auxiliary device triggering without tying up the strike relay. Size the camera load accordingly — 0.5A at 125VAC is the ceiling on the AC side.
  • High-Resolution Color Video Camera: The built-in color camera provides visual confirmation of the visitor at the door — reducing tailgating risk and giving residents enough detail to make an informed admit decision. Pair this with a video door station monitor at the tenant unit for a complete visual entry system.
  • IP66 Ingress Protection: IP66 means the enclosure withstands direct, high-pressure water jets and complete dust exclusion — handling rain-driven entry alcoves, wash-down areas, and vehicle entrances where spray is routine. It does not cover submersion; if the unit sits in a flood-prone sump or below-grade entry, IP67 or higher is the appropriate spec.
  • Wide Operating Temperature Range (-35°C to 66°C): A -35°C floor is genuinely cold-weather capable — northern U.S. winters, Canadian installs, and unheated parking garage entries are all within spec. The 66°C upper limit handles direct-sun south-facing entries in hot climates without thermal shutdown.
  • 12–24V AC/DC Power Input: Broad input voltage tolerance means compatibility with nearly any low-voltage transformer or existing power infrastructure on site. No dedicated power supply SKU required for most retrofits — check your existing transformer's output and verify it falls in range before ordering.
  • Heavy-Duty Metal Keypad with Hex-Drive Security Screws: Metal keypad construction resists key strikes and impact abuse common at unsupervised entry points. Hex-drive (tamper-resistant) mounting screws deter casual removal — a practical deterrent in high-traffic or publicly accessible vestibules.
  • Enhanced Weather Protection (EWP) via Optional VE-5x10: The K-1205-EWP designation indicates the unit ships ready to integrate with the VE-5x10 surface enclosure, which adds a weather hood and additional gasket protection for fully exposed outdoor mounting. If the entry point has no architectural overhang, plan for the VE-5x10 at time of order.

Integration and Compatibility

The K-1205-EWP operates on standard analog telephone infrastructure — it connects to existing PABX systems, analog telephone adapters (ATAs), or direct PSTN lines. For VoIP deployments, Viking's K-1205-IP variant handles SIP/PoE natively; the K-1205-EWP is the analog-line solution. Power the unit from any 12–24V AC/DC source; rough-in dimensions of 4.5" x 9.12" x 2.5" (114mm x 232mm x 64mm) fit standard 4-inch gang rough-in boxes. Review entry phone selection criteria if you are deciding between analog and VoIP entry architectures. For multi-door deployments, the 12-button capacity and dual-relay design keep wiring clean — one home run per entry panel rather than a relay expander per door.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What power supply does the K-1205-EWP require?

A: The K-1205-EWP accepts 12 to 24 volts AC or DC, giving you flexibility to use an existing low-voltage transformer or a standard plug-in adapter within that range. No proprietary power supply is required.

Q: What is the door strike relay rating on the K-1205-EWP?

A: The integrated door strike relay is rated 5A at 30VDC or 250VAC — sufficient for the vast majority of electric strikes and magnetic locks without an external relay module.

Q: Is the K-1205-EWP suitable for outdoor installations in cold climates?

A: Yes. The operating temperature range is -35°C to 66°C, making it appropriate for northern U.S. and Canadian winters. The IP66 rating handles rain and dust. For fully exposed (no-overhang) installations, add the optional VE-5x10 enclosure for enhanced weather protection.

Q: What is the warranty on the K-1205-EWP?

A: Viking Electronics provides a two-year limited manufacturer warranty on the K-1205-EWP.

Q: Can I program a backup phone number for each tenant button?

A: Yes. The K-1205-EWP supports 12 alternate number positions — one per button — so you can configure a primary and a rollover number (such as a cell phone) for each tenant position.

Q: What is the difference between the K-1205-EWP and the K-1205-IP?

A: The K-1205-EWP is an analog telephone entry phone powered by a 12–24V AC/DC supply; it connects to standard PABX or PSTN lines. The K-1205-IP is a VoIP (SIP) entry phone powered by PoE (under 6.5W, Class 2) and connects to IP telephone systems. Choose based on your site's telephone infrastructure.

The K-1205-EWP is one of the more straightforward apartment entry installs I run across — Viking built the dual-relay architecture (5A strike relay plus a separate 0.5A camera relay) directly into the panel, which eliminates the relay expander box that shows up in a lot of competing analog entry system designs. That spec alone simplifies the rough-in considerably on a 12-unit building.

Technical Highlights:

  • -35°C to 66°C Operating Range: That -35°C floor is not a marketing number — it covers unheated vestibule installs in Minnesota or Alberta without a heater kit. Most competing analog entry panels are rated to -20°C or -10°C; Viking's cold-weather floor is a genuine differentiator for northern deployments.
  • Dual Relay Design (5A Strike + 0.5A Camera): Having two independent relays means you're not splitting the strike relay between door control and video switching. The 5A rating at 30VDC handles heavy-duty magnetic locks; the camera relay keeps the video circuit isolated so a strike surge doesn't corrupt the video signal.
  • 316 Stainless Steel, 14-Gauge Faceplate: 14-gauge is meaningfully thicker than the 16-gauge or stamped-aluminum faceplates you'll find on budget entry panels. 316 alloy is the coastal and pool-environment grade — if the property manager has replaced corroded faceplates before, this is the spec that ends that conversation.

Deployment Considerations:

  • The unit's rough-in box dimensions are 4.5" x 9.12" x 2.5" — verify the existing rough-in cavity on retrofit jobs before cutting. New construction is straightforward; replacing a competitor's smaller footprint panel may require patch work.
  • The camera relay is rated 0.5A at 125VAC — verify your video monitor or switching equipment draws within that ceiling. Exceeding it on the AC side will trip the relay over time; use a DC-powered monitor where possible and stay within the 1.0A at 30VDC rating.

This unit is a strong fit for 6-to-12 unit apartment buildings on analog telephone infrastructure where the property owner wants a vandal-resistant, cold-climate-capable entry system without migrating to a VoIP platform. If the site is already on SIP/IP phones, spec the K-1205-IP instead and pick up PoE power delivery in the bargain.
